Development of Drama as a form : Introduction : Drama is generally thought to have started increase between 600 and 200 BC, although some critics trace it to Egyptian religious rights of coronation. The origin of the drama is deep-rooted in the religious predispositions of mankind. This is the case not only with English drama, but with dramas of other nations as well. The ancient Greek and Roman dramas were mostly concerned with religious ceremonials of people. It was the religious elements that resulted in the development of drama. Interpret and 2. Judgement. ➡️ Introduction :        ‘ In introduction to the Study of Literature 'W. H. Hudson explains that literary criticism perform several vital functions among which Interpretation and Judgement are on central importance. Hudson believes that critics should guide readers to a deeper understanding of literature and help them evaluate it's artistic worth.
